From: YanTeng Si In-Reply-To: <4hqv526s32ldakdd3f6ue26q2sajdreyfdrivlwpmhpovwcjns@n7t7u2yqceaw>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8; format=flowed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it X-Migadu-Flow: FLOW_OUT 在 2024/8/7 3:17, Serge Semin 写道: > On Tue, Aug 06, 2024 at 07:00:22PM +0800, Yanteng Si wrote: >> The Loongson DWMAC driver currently supports the Loongson GMAC >> devices (based on the DW GMAC v3.50a/v3.73a IP-core) installed to the >> LS2K1000 SoC and LS7A1000 chipset. But recently a new generation >> LS2K2000 SoC was released with the new version of the Loongson GMAC >> synthesized in. The new controller is based on the DW GMAC v3.73a >> IP-core with the AV-feature enabled, which implies the multi >> DMA-channels support. The multi DMA-channels feature has the next >> vendor-specific peculiarities: >> >> 1. Split up Tx and Rx DMA IRQ status/mask bits: >> Name Tx Rx >> DMA_INTR_ENA_NIE = 0x00040000 | 0x00020000; >> DMA_INTR_ENA_AIE = 0x00010000 | 0x00008000; >> DMA_STATUS_NIS = 0x00040000 | 0x00020000; >> DMA_STATUS_AIS = 0x00010000 | 0x00008000; >> DMA_STATUS_FBI = 0x00002000 | 0x00001000; >> 2. Custom Synopsys ID hardwired into the GMAC_VERSION.SNPSVER register >> field. It's 0x10 while it should have been 0x37 in accordance with >> the actual DW GMAC IP-core version. >> 3. There are eight DMA-channels available meanwhile the Synopsys DW >> GMAC IP-core supports up to three DMA-channels. >> 4. It's possible to have each DMA-channel IRQ independently delivered. >> The MSI IRQs must be utilized for that. >> >> Thus in order to have the multi-channels Loongson GMAC controllers >> supported let's modify the Loongson DWMAC driver in accordance with >> all the peculiarities described above: >> >> 1. Create the multi-channels Loongson GMAC-specific >> stmmac_dma_ops::dma_interrupt() >> stmmac_dma_ops::init_chan() >> callbacks due to the non-standard DMA IRQ CSR flags layout. >> 2. Create the Loongson DWMAC-specific platform setup() method >> which gets to initialize the DMA-ops with the dwmac1000_dma_ops >> instance and overrides the callbacks described in 1. The method also >> overrides the custom Synopsys ID with the real one in order to have >> the rest of the HW-specific callbacks correctly detected by the driver >> core. >> 3.
